YMCA of Greenwich Expands Summer Camp Programming To Meet Growing Community Needs

For more than 110 years, the YMCA of Greenwich has served as a cornerstone of the Greenwich community—responding to evolving needs and ensuring that children, families, and working caregivers have the support they need to learn, grow, and thrive. This summer, the YMCA is expanding its summer camp offerings through a new collaboration with Scouting America Greenwich, allowing YMCA programs to operate at the historic Camp Seton beginning summer 2026.

Greenwich Botanical Center’s May Gardener’s Market Will Bloom on Saturday, May 2, 2026

Greenwich Botanical Center's May Gardener's Market will be held Saturday, May 2 from 9:00am to 4:00pm. With plants galore, gardening accessories, cut flowers and much-anticipated Plant of the Year, the bustling market is the best way to start summer gardens, while supporting GBC and its mission to connect people of all ages with plants and nature.  There will be three speakers to educate the crowd on roses, container gardens and new annuals.
